Matrix Advisors Value Fund has disclosed a total of 18 changes to the portfolio in the (2023 Q3) SEC report(s): increased the number of shares of 5, bought 1 totally new, decreased the number of shares of 11 and completely sold out 1 position(s).

What stocks did David Katz buy in 2023 Q3?

During 2023 Q3 David Katz has bought 6 securities out of which top 5 purchases (by % change to portfolio) were (PNC) PNC Financial Services Group Inc (added shares +17.11%), (LHX) L3Harris Technologies Inc (added shares +56.20%), (UNH) U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(added shares +328.08%), (GILD) Gilead Sciences Inc (added shares +20.39%) and (RTX) RTX Corp (new buy).

What did David Katz invest in during 2023 Q3?

David Katz's top 5 holdings (by % of portfolio) were (MSFT) Microsoft Corp (7.39%), (GOOG) Alphabet Inc, CL-C (6.99%), (AAPL) Apple Inc (5.20%), (JPM) JPMorgan Chase & Co (4.30%) and (META) Meta Platforms Inc (4.18%).
In the 2023 Q3 report(s) the following changes have been made to the top investments: (MSFT) Microsoft Corp (reduced shares -1.57%) and (JPM) JPMorgan Chase & Co (reduced shares -4.79%).
